【C16】
选项
A、transparent
B、temperament
C、contemporary
D、temporary
答案
D
解析
词义辨析。本句大意为“拥有积极心态的年轻人往往把挫折和麻烦看作是暂时的”。词义辨析:transparent透明的,temperament性情,contemporary当代的,temporary短暂的,故只有D选项符合题意。
